Job Summary

  • The role involves developing specialized assets like playbooks and technology tools to help companies build resilient international trade lanes.
  • Candidates will conduct tailored trade corridor diagnostics to assist businesses in navigating geopolitical challenges and seizing growth opportunities.
  • This position requires collaborating with Trade & Customs and Tax & Incentives teams to deliver integrated solutions for global clients.
